The Granby Memorial Bears entered their tilt with the Bolton Bulldogs with six consecutive wins but they'll enter their next game with seven. Granby Memorial took down Bolton 54-39 on Thursday. That's another feather in the cap for Granby Memorial, who also won these teams' last head-to-head.
Despite the loss, Bolton still got an impressive performance from Makenna Graves, who dropped a double-double on 11 points and 15 rebounds. Graves has been hot recently, having posted three or more steals the last three times she's played. Niya Islam was another key contributor, scoring 13 points along with eight rebounds.
Granby Memorial's win was their sixth straight at home, which pushed their record up to 15-4. As for Bolton, they have been struggling recently as they've lost three of their last four matchups, which put a noticeable dent in their 11-6 record this season.
